First Computer
Difference Engine invented by Charles Babbage aka "father of the computer" The design describes a machine to calculate a series of values and print results automatically in a table. -
First Working Programmable Computer
Z3 invented by Konrad Zuse. Z3 was a secret project of the German government, put to use by the German Aircraft Research Institute in order to perform statistical analyses of wing flutter. -
First Trackball
The Trackball invented by Ralph Benjamin for fire-control radar plotting system named Comprehensive Display System(CDS) -
First Programmable Computer
Colossus was invented by Tommy Flowers. It was used by the British to read secret German messages (encrypted by the Lorenz cipher) during World War II. -
First Real-Time Graphics Display Computer
The AN/FSQ-7, developed by IBM, was by far the largest computer ever built. It consisted of 2 Whirlwind II computers installed in a 4-story building. t was a control and command system used in the air defense network. It calculated one or more predicted interception points for assigning aircraft or CIM-10 Bomarc missiles to intercept an intruder using the ATABE (Automatic Target and Battery Evaluation) algorithm.
